Background
At present, wall surfaces of windows in various rooms are different in width, and therefore, the curtain machine is produced and installed in a mode that the width of the wall surface of the window is measured firstly, and then the curtain machine is produced in a workshop according to the width size, and the mode has the defects that: firstly, on-site measurement is needed, manpower is wasted, and if measurement or manufacturing is wrong, reworking is needed, so that working hours and materials are wasted; secondly, the mode can only be customized by a single machine, the efficiency is low, and the cost is high; moreover, the method is customized by a single machine, and mass production cannot be realized. Once the length of the curtain guide rail is determined, the curtain guide rail can only be used on a corresponding window, and once the size of the window is changed due to decoration and the like, the curtain guide rail with the original size cannot be used continuously or adjusted, so that waste is generated.
CN2516065Y discloses a length-adjustable electric curtain rail, which is composed of a main rail, an auxiliary rail, a traction tackle, a suspension loop, a connecting pulley, a traction rope, a driven pulley, a driven bracket, a side power driving head, a center guide wheel bracket and a bracket positioning rope. The electric curtain guide rail uses the connecting slide block to transversely juxtapose the main guide rail and the auxiliary guide rail into a whole, so that the using length of the whole track system can be adjusted at will. However, the arrangement and structural design of the center guide wheel and the center guide wheel bracket of the electric curtain guide rail lead to larger overall volume of the curtain structure, the traction rope needs to change the transmission direction through the center guide wheel twice, the synchronization performance of the main guide rail and the auxiliary guide rail is poorer, faults are easy to occur, and the installation and the disassembly of the traction pulley of the curtain guide rail are very inconvenient.

Referring to fig. 1-5, the present invention provides a telescopically adjustable window curtain rail embodiment, which comprises a first rail 1, a second rail 2, an endless belt 3, a first pulley mechanism 6 and a second pulley mechanism 4. When the curtain guide rail is installed, a customer can adjust the length of the annular belt 3 at the overlapped part of the first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2 according to the actual requirement of the customer, so that the length of the overlapped part of the first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2 is adjusted, the whole length of the first guide rail 1 and the whole length of the second guide rail 2 can be adjusted according to the requirement, the adjustment is simple and convenient, the size is not customized, and the applicability and the use performance are very high.
Referring to fig. 2, the second guide rail 2 and the first guide rail 1 are arranged in parallel, a first sliding groove 11 is formed in one side edge of the first guide rail 1, the second guide rail 2 is in contact with an end face of the first sliding groove 11 of the first guide rail 1, and a closed space is formed between the first sliding groove 11 and a side face of the second guide rail 2. As shown in fig. 1, a first driving head 15 and a second adapter 16 are respectively installed at two ends of a first guide rail 1, a driving wheel 12 is installed in the first driving head 15, and a first reversing wheel 13 is installed in the second adapter 16.
It can be understood that the first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2 can slide along the length direction of the two, the end of the second guide rail 2 on the first guide rail 1 is provided with a first adapter 21, the other end of the second guide rail 2 is provided with a second driving head 26, and the second driving head 26 is internally provided with a second reversing wheel 22.
Referring to fig. 1, a first guide wheel 23 and a second guide wheel 24 are installed in the first rotary joint 21, the first guide wheel 23 is located between the second guide wheel 24 and the second diverting wheel 22, and the second guide wheel 23 is located above the outer side of the first guide wheel 24.
Specifically, the outer common tangent of the first guide wheel 23 and the second guide wheel 24 is obliquely arranged with the first guide rail 1. Second adapter 16 and first adapter 21 are directly pegged graft at the tip of first guide rail 1 and second guide rail 2, and for the prior art of background art, first leading wheel 23 and second leading wheel 24 are located the tip of second guide rail 2, install the tip at second guide rail 2 through first adapter 21, reduce the guide rail thickness, effectively reduce the volume of (window) curtain.
As will be understood, with reference to fig. 1, the line connecting the lower end of the first guide wheel 23 and the upper end of the first diverting wheel 13 is parallel to the first guide rail 1, ensuring that the endless belt 3, which is wound from the first chute 11 into the first guide wheel 23, is wound tangentially from the bottom end into the first guide wheel 23. The upper end of the first guide wheel 23 is lower than the upper end of the second guide rail 2, which ensures that the endless belt 3 diverted from the second diverting wheel 22 into the second guide rail 2 does not interfere with the first guide wheel 23.
As shown in fig. 1, the first guide wheel 23 and the first diverting wheel 13 are respectively located at two sides of the endless belt 3, and the second guide wheel 24 and the second diverting wheel 22 are respectively located at the same side of the endless belt 3, so that compared with the electric curtain rail of the background art, the times of changing the direction of the endless belt 3 is reduced, the synchronism of the movement of the first rail 1 and the second rail 2 can be improved, and the curtain failure rate is reduced. The distance from the circle center of the first guide wheel 23 to the first guide rail 1 is smaller than the distance from the circle center of the second guide wheel 24 to the first guide rail 1, so that the first guide wheel 23 and the second guide wheel 24 are obliquely staggered, the annular belt 3 can be connected with the first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2, and the curtain guide rail is telescopic.
In one embodiment, the first press wheel 5a is arranged on the outside of the endless belt 3 running from the first guide wheel 23. The first pinch roller 5a presses the annular belt 3 bent by the first guide wheel 23 downwards, so that the annular belt 3 can be wound into the first reversing wheel 13 from the lower end of the second guide rail 2.
Referring to fig. 1, a second pressure wheel 5b and a third pressure wheel 5c are respectively arranged on the outer sides of the annular belts 3 wound in and out from the second guide wheels 24, the third pressure wheel 5c is positioned on the outer side of the annular belt 3 between the driving wheel 12 and the second guide wheels 24, the second pressure wheel 5b is positioned on the outer side of the annular belt 3 between the second guide wheels 24 and the second reversing wheels 22, and the lower ends of the third pressure wheels 5c are arranged in a tangent manner with the top end of the first guide rail 1, so that the annular belts 3 can be prevented from being in contact with the first guide rail 1, and the annular belts 3 are prevented from being damaged.
It can be understood that, as shown in fig. 1, when the first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2 are stretched, the first sliding groove 11 of the first guide rail 1 is offset from the second guide rail 2, so that the endless belt 3 is directly exposed to the outside, which easily causes the endless belt 3 to be contaminated with dust and the like, resulting in a reduction in the life of the endless belt 3, and on the other hand, the endless belt 3 is directly exposed, which greatly reduces the overall aesthetic appearance of the appearance.
Therefore, in the practical use process, a thin aluminum plate can be taken as a cover plate, after the first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2 are stretched towards two sides, the required length of the thin aluminum plate is cut according to the length of the exposed first sliding groove 11, and then the thin aluminum plate is directly fixed on the first guide rail 1, so that dust can be effectively prevented, the service life of the annular belt 3 can be effectively prolonged, and the appearance consistency of the curtain system can be improved.

In the present embodiment, the endless belt 3 may be selected to be a synchronous belt. The endless belt 3 is wound around a drive pulley 12, a first diverting pulley 13, a first guide pulley 23, a second diverting pulley 22, and a second guide pulley 24 in this order. It will be appreciated that the minimum spacing between the first guide wheel 23 and the second guide wheel 24 is greater than the cross-sectional width of the endless belt 3 and can accommodate the passage of the endless belt 3. The driving wheel 12 is driven to rotate to drive the annular belt 3 to move, so that the first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2 are driven to move in opposite directions or in relative motion, and the whole length of the guide rails is shortened or stretched.
Referring to fig. 2, the bottom portions of the first and second guide rails 1 and 2 are provided with first and second openings 14 and 25, respectively, which are provided along the length direction of the first and second guide rails 1 and 2. Be provided with first coaster mechanism 6 and second coaster mechanism 4 on first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2 respectively, first coaster mechanism 6 stretches out from first opening 14, second coaster mechanism 4 stretches out from second opening 25, endless belt 3 is the opening form, 3 opening both ends in endless belt are fixed respectively in the both sides of first coaster mechanism 6, constitute a airtight endless belt through first coaster mechanism 6, drive first guide rail 1 and the extension of second guide rail 2 or shorten, second coaster mechanism 4 detachably fixes on endless belt 3.
Wherein, first coaster mechanism 6 includes coaster main part, open structure A, open structure B, and open structure A and open structure B pass through screw and coaster main part fixed connection, and the both ends head of annular area 3 is fixed with open structure A and open structure B respectively.
The curtain guide rail works as follows, when the motor connected with the first driving head 15 rotates, the driving wheel 12 is driven to rotate, the annular belt 3 wound on the driving wheel 12 moves, the first pulley mechanism 6 and the second pulley mechanism 4 on the first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2 are fixed with the annular belt 3, and along with the movement of the annular belt 3, the first pulley mechanism 6 and the second pulley mechanism 4 synchronously move in opposite directions at a constant speed, so that the curtain completes the closing or opening action. The distances between the first pulley mechanism 6 and the second pulley mechanism 4 and the two ends of the first guide rail 1 and the second guide rail 2 can be adjusted according to actual needs and then fixed.
Specifically, referring to fig. 2, the second sled mechanism 4 includes a groove structure 41 and a weight structure 42, the groove structure 41 includes a groove portion 411 located inside the second rail 2 and a fixing portion 412 protruding from the second opening 25, the groove of the groove portion 411 is disposed toward the center of the second rail 2, and the groove portion 411 is located entirely inside the rail on the side of the second opening 25. The pressing block structure 42 includes an engaging portion 421 located in the groove portion 411 and a pressing plate 422 protruding from the second opening 25, the annular band 3 is installed between the groove portion 411 and the engaging portion 421, the engaging portion 421 engages with the annular band 3, and the pressing plate 422 is fixed to the fixing portion 412 by the screw 43. The screws 43 are tightened or loosened, and the annular band 3 is fixed or loosened to the engaging portion 421. The groove structure 41 and the pressing block structure 42 are directly fixed by using the screws 43, so that the assembly and disassembly are very convenient.
The second pulley mechanism 4 is meshed with the annular belt 3 through the meshing part 421, then the pressing plate 422 and the fixing part 412 are fixed through the screw 43, when the distance between the first pulley mechanism 6 and the second pulley mechanism 4 of the curtain does not meet the requirement, the screw 43 can be loosened, the pressing plate 422 and the fixing part 412 are loosened, the annular belt 3 is separated from the meshing part 421, the second pulley mechanism 4 can be pushed to slide at the moment, the distance between the second pulley mechanism 4 and the required position is adjusted, after the distance between the second pulley mechanism 4 is adjusted, the screw 43 is screwed, the annular belt 3 is meshed and locked with the meshing part 421, and the second pulley mechanism 4 is very convenient to install and adjust. Compared with the prior art, the distance between the first pulley mechanism 6 and the second pulley mechanism 4 can be freely adjusted, which is beneficial to the installation of curtains.
